This project focuses on the design of a game to promote academic integrity, addressing issues like plagiarism and cheating. The game, tentatively named 'Dignity,' is designed for multiple players, including a professor whose identity is concealed to observe student behavior. The game involves answering questions and penalizes players who attempt to use external resources. The project emphasizes the importance of ethical behavior and the development of a strong foundation in computer design and development, including character animation, environment design, and user interfaces. The project also discusses the skills required to participate in the game, the importance of academic integrity, and the role of institutions in preventing misconduct. The project aims to create an engaging and effective tool for teaching students about academic integrity while also providing a practical application of game design principles.
